Easter Egg Case Hunt & Safari

Join the Marine Warden on a Seashore Safari to explore the fascinating creatures of the seashore and how they live, eat and adapt to their environment!

Get involved with Citizen Science! We will be hunting for shark and ray egg cases, which we will record for The Shark Trust to aid in their research, so they know which species lay eggs in our waters and how climatic factors and environmental changes may effect them. All equipment is provided.

Suitable for any age, this event is run at Charmouth and runs for 2 hours.
